I have a BlackVue DR750X 2 channel dash cam which I’m happy with, you can fit a SIM card to it and have access to live footage from anywhere on connect it to a WI-FI and access it through that.
Only issue I’ve had is it occasionally locks up and needs the power lead unplugging and reconnecting to reboot it, I think it may be overheating in the sun.
Here are a couple of clips, one from the front and one from the rear.

I have Viofo in my cars and can recommend them. They have great image quality, discreet & reliable install and forget devices with good software updates, yet relatively inexpensive. Had them for five years now. They have no wifi so if you need to review the footage, just pick it up and connect with USB to your computer, which, IMO is easier than than wifi.
